**Changelog — Lintwright 2.8 defaults**

The static-analysis baseline file is now generated per-package instead of one repo-wide file. New findings fail the build; baselined ones only warn. Existing baselines were split automatically, so no action needed on merge. For reference, the generator now runs with the following default settings.

deployment values, taduf-fawig:
WENAEL_HOST=wenael.zemvarlabs.internal
WENAEL_PORT=8443

**Ticket: Timetabler staging env is busted**

Hey, flagging this for review: the Chalkline timetable solver in staging is pointed at the prod constraints database, which is why teachers at the demo school saw real schedules. We need SOLVER_ENV=staging and CONSTRAINT_DB=chalkline_stage in the .env. Also, the solver can't reach the queue without its credential, so the fix adds that line next.

vault entry, yajop-bafop: ARCHIVE_KEY3=8d4

CI note: if the undo/redo suite for Inkplot (our diagram editor) flakes, it's almost always the history-stack snapshot test racing the canvas render. Rerun once before digging in. Still red twice? Check whether the command-merge window changed in config. When you escalate, paste the failing build's token, which sits just below this note.

pipeline stamp: htk9_ce63042d9